Key stakeholder

The term key stakeholder is used to identify members of the sub-group of stakeholders who have the power to substantially damage the project and may potentially cause it to fail. This group are both important and influential/powerful; they may be individuals such as an important manager or entities such as a regulatory authority. Key ....

Key stakeholders are those who can significantly influence, or are important to the success of, the project.
